+/**
+ * Samuel Yvon's entry.
+ * <p>
+ * Explanation behind my reasoning:
+ * - I want to make it as fast as possible without it being an unreadable mess; I want to avoid bit fiddling UTF-8
+ * and use the provided facilities
+ * - I use the fact that we know the number of stations to optimize HashMap creation (75% rule)
+ * - I stole branch-less compare from royvanrijn
+ * - I assume valid ASCII encoding for the number part, which allows me to parse it manually
+ * (should hold for valid UTF-8)
+ * - I have not done Java in forever. Especially what the heck it's become. I've looked at the other submissions and
+ * the given sample to get inspiration. I did not even know about this Stream API thing.
+ * </p>
+ *
+ * <p>
+ * Future ideas:
+ * - Probably can Vector-Apirize the number parsing (but it's three to four numbers, is it worth?)
+ * </p>
+ *
+ * <p>
+ * Observations:
+ * - [2024-01-09] The branch-less code from royvarijn does not have a huge impact
+ * </p>
+ *
+ * <p>
+ * Changelogs:
+ * 2024-01-09: Naive multi-threaded, no floats, manual line parsing
+ * </p>
+ */

+ /**
+ * Branchless min (unprecise for large numbers, but good enough)
+ *
+ * @author royvanrijn
+ */
+ private static int branchlessMax(final int a, final int b) {
+ final int diff = a - b;
+ final int dsgn = diff >> 31;
+ return a - (diff & dsgn);
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Branchless min (unprecise for large numbers, but good enough)
+ *
+ * @author royvanrijn
+ */
+ private static int branchlessMin(final int a, final int b) {
+ final int diff = a - b;
+ final int dsgn = diff >> 31;
+ return b + (diff & dsgn);
+ }

+ private static HashMap<String, StationMeasureAgg> parseChunk(MappedByteBuffer chunk) {
+ HashMap<String, StationMeasureAgg> m = HashMap.newHashMap(MAX_STATIONS);
+
+ int i = 0;
+ while (i < chunk.limit()) {
+ int j = i;
+ for (; j < chunk.limit(); ++j) {
+ // TODO: Could compute a hash here, store a byte array, and decode UTF-8 at the
+ // latest moment.
+ if (chunk.get(j) == SEMICOL) {
+ break;
+ }
+ }
+
+ byte[] backingNameArray = new byte[j - i];
+ chunk.get(i, backingNameArray);
+ String name = new String(backingNameArray, StandardCharsets.UTF_8);
+
+ // Skip the `;`
+ j++;
+
+ // Parse the int ourselves, avoids a 'String::replace' to remove the
+ // digit.
+ int temp = 0;
+ boolean neg = chunk.get(j) == MINUS;
+ for (j = j + (neg ? 1 : 0); j < chunk.limit(); ++j) {
+ temp *= 10;
+ byte c = chunk.get(j);
+ if (c != '.') {
+ temp += (char) (c - ZERO);
+ }
+ else {
+ j++;
+ break;
+ }
+ }
+
+ // The decimal point
+ temp += (char) (chunk.get(j) - ZERO);
+
+ i = j + 1;
+
+ while (chunk.get(i++) != '\n')
+ ;
+
+ if (neg)
+ temp = -temp;
+
+ m.computeIfAbsent(name, StationMeasureAgg::new).accumulate(temp);
+ }
+
+ return m;
+ }
